Cilia and flagella share a common structure, with a microtubular core which has a 9+2 organization with nine paired doublets of microtubules surrounding a central pair to form the axoneme. Axoneme is surrounded by plasma membrane and anchored to the inside of cell by the kinetosome formed from nine microtubular triplets connected to the nine doublets in axoneme. Cilia can fuse to make even bigger structures, creating complex ciliature like cirri and membranelles.
